Overview

• Mastercard Loyalty Solution is a leading provider of loyalty and rewards services to financial institutions across the Asia Pacific region. Previously known as Pinpoint, with the Headquarters in Sydney, is Australia’s leading rewards program manager, and as officially acquired by Mastercard Group and rebranded to Mastercard Loyalty Solutions, we are equipped with stronger penetration into the industry of financial institutions and a growing footprint across the region into key markets such as China, Hong Kong, India, Taiwan and Japan.
